随着互联网技术的迅猛发展,网站安全问题也日益凸显。ASP(Active Server Pages)作为一种常用的服务器端脚本环境,在国内拥有大量用户。为了保障基于ASP架构的Web应用程序免受黑客攻击,确保其稳定运行,必须遵循一系列的安全设置指南。
一、更新与维护
1. 定期更新:及时安装来自微软官方发布的最新版本和安全补丁。由于ASP是基于Windows平台开发的技术,所以要特别关注Windows操作系统的更新情况,以保证底层系统没有已知漏洞。
2. 程序库维护:对于使用到的第三方组件或类库,也要保持跟踪其最新的稳定版,并进行相应的升级工作。
二、身份验证与授权
1. 强化密码策略:要求用户创建足够复杂度的密码,如包含大小写字母、数字及特殊字符;同时限制登录失败次数,防止暴力破解尝试。
2. 采用多因素认证:除了传统的用户名/密码组合外,还可以引入短信验证码、图形验证码等额外验证手段,提高账户安全性。
3. 细粒度权限控制:根据实际业务需求为不同角色分配最小化的操作权限,避免不必要的信息暴露风险。
三、数据传输保护
1. HTTPS加密:通过SSL/TLS协议对客户端与服务器之间的所有通信内容进行加密处理,防止中间人窃听敏感数据。
2. 防止SQL注入:在编写SQL语句时尽量使用参数化查询方式代替直接拼接字符串;另外还可以考虑启用数据库层面上的防火墙功能来进一步增强防护效果。
四、文件上传管理
1. 限定允许类型:只接受特定格式(例如图片、文档等)且经过严格校验后的文件提交,拒绝其他可能携带恶意代码的附件。
2. 设置存储路径:将上传文件存放在独立于Web根目录之外的位置,并确保该位置不可被直接访问到。
3. 进行病毒扫描:利用专业的杀毒软件对每个待保存下来的文件进行实时检测,一旦发现异常立即隔离处理。
五、日志记录与监控
1. 完整的日志体系:记录下每一次请求的时间戳、来源IP地址、执行动作等关键要素,以便事后追溯分析。
2. 实时告警机制:当监测到潜在威胁行为时(比如频繁尝试错误密码),能够第一时间通知管理员采取应对措施。
六、结语
遵循上述这些防范黑客攻击的最佳实践可以有效提升基于ASP架构的Web应用的整体安全性水平。当然这只是一个开始,在实际部署过程中还需要结合具体场景不断调整优化策略,从而构建出一个更加坚固可靠的网络空间。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/180320.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。